Comparable Facts
Compare Northeastern University in Boston, MA with Stevens Institute of Technology in Hoboken, NJ on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
Northeastern University is larger than Stevens based on total student enrollment (32,553 students vs. 8,469 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- Northeastern University is located in Boston, MA (Large City setting); Stevens Institute of Technology is in Hoboken, NJ (Large Suburban setting).
- Northeastern University is a private, non-profit 4-year institution. Stevens Institute of Technology is a private, non-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: Northeastern University 16:1; Stevens Institute of Technology 11:1.
Northeastern vs. Stevens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Northeastern or Stevens?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Northeastern University than Stevens ($34,207 vs. $46,165).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Stevens Institute of Technology are 2.3% lower than at Northeastern University ($19,124 vs. $19,580).
- Northeastern University is 4.3% more expensive for in-state tuition than Stevens (about $2,700 more per year; $66,162.00 vs. $63,462.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 4.3% higher at Northeastern than at Stevens Institute of Technology (about $2,700 more per year; $66,162.00 vs. $63,462.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Stevens Institute of Technology than at Northeastern University (98% vs. 66%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Northeastern University students is 48.7% larger than aid received by Stevens Institute of Technology students ($50,421 vs. $33,897).
Northeastern vs. Stevens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, Northeastern or Stevens?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between Stevens and Northeastern.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Northeastern University (1490) is 50 points higher than at Stevens (1440).
- Incoming Northeastern students have a 2 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(34 vs. 32 at Stevens).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Northeastern University 1440/1540; Stevens Institute of Technology 1380/1505.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Northeastern University 33/35; Stevens Institute of Technology 31/34.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: Northeastern - Test optional; Stevens - Test optional.
- Typical fall application deadline: Northeastern Jan 1, 2027.
- Accepted freshman Northeastern students have a 0.03 point higher average high school GPA (3.91) than students at Stevens (3.88).
- Stevens has a higher acceptance rate (47.6%) than Northeastern (5.2%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 53.8% at Northeastern vs. 20.8% at Stevens.
Northeastern vs. Stevens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Northeastern and Stevens?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Stevens Institute of Technology's six-year graduation rate (79%) is higher than Northeastern University's (77%).
- Graduates from Stevens Institute of Technology earn a median of about $19,600 more per year than Northeastern graduates about ten years after starting college ($89,100 vs. $69,500),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, Northeastern University graduates have a $375 lower median loan debt than Stevens graduates ($27,875 vs. $28,250).
- Among borrowers, Northeastern graduates have an estimated $4 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Stevens graduates ($288 vs. $292).
- More Stevens gra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Northeastern students, three years after graduation. (89% vs. 79%)
